about

A Lethal Smile, a metal band from Stockholm, Sweden. Founded in July 2015. A Lethal Smile crossing the boundaries of different metal genres with their unique death/nu/alternative-metal sound, A Lethal Smile found fame after they emerged from the Stockholm suburbs by former bandmates of local bands seeking their way out of the "classical” core-scene. By experimenting and setting aside djent/core tendencies, they found their own way of presenting their hateful and angry messages. Sticking with the familiar growls of late-metal blended with clean tones, vocalist Sebastian Frisk brings the pure emotion of the band on top of the heavy and rock-steady riffs of Guitarist blended with the memorable virtuose lead guitar of Andreas Hjalmarsson. Together with the low and crushing foundation of bass-guitarist Ludvig Garnås and the quick but heavy beats from drummer Andreas Karlsson the sound of "A Lethal Smile" would come to be something different from what they said to be the "core-scene".
